What is the difference between a gauge ring and a limit plug gauge?

A gauge ring and a limit plug gauge serve the same goal: ensuring dimensional accuracy in production, but they check opposite features. A gauge ring verifies the external diameter of shafts using go/no-go criteria, while a limit plug gauge (also called a limit plug) inspects internal bores or threads. Both are essential for quality control in machining and series production, offering quick Go/No‑Go decisions to confirm parts meet specified tolerances.

Clear distinction between a ring gauge and a limit plug gauge

A Ring Gauge and a Limit Plug Gauge are both fundamental Measuring Tools used to check dimensions quickly and reliably in production, but they serve different geometric purposes. A Ring Gauge is used for external diameters, shafts or cylindrical parts: the part must fit into the ring to confirm the external size is within tolerance. Conversely, a Limit Plug Gauge is a go/no-go style inspection tool for internal diameters such as bores or threaded holes. The limit plug gauge checks whether the inside dimension of a bore or thread meets the required limits by having a Go side that must enter and a No-Go side that must not fully enter.

How each tool works in practice and when to use them

Operators use a Ring Gauge by attempting to slide the shaft or cylindrical feature into the ring. If the part enters the Go ring easily and does not enter the No-Go ring, the part is accepted. In contrast, a Limit Plug Gauge functions on the same Good/Reject principle for internal features: the Go end of the plug must fully enter the bore; the No-Go end must not. Use a Ring Gauge when you need a fast, repeatable check of external diameters and shaft geometry. Choose a Limit Plug Gauge when assessing bores, internal diameters or internal threads to ensure they are within tolerance.

Why these gauges matter for quality control and process reliability

Precise inspection with Ring Gauges and Limit Plug Gauges reduces scrap, rework and costly downstream failures. They enable rapid decisions on whether a part conforms to dimensional specifications without the need for time-consuming measurements on coordinate measuring machines. In high-volume manufacturing and serial production, these gauges are indispensable for first article inspection, in-process checks and final inspection, ensuring consistent part interchangeability and assembly fit.

Practical differences and how they complement other inspection methods

A Ring Gauge gives immediate go/no-go results for external diameters and is especially useful where quick gauging is required. A Limit Plug Gauge provides the same immediacy for internal diameters and internal thread acceptance. Compared to full measuring instruments, such as micrometers or calipers, these gauges do not provide continuous measurement values; instead they offer rapid conformity checks. When traceable measurement values are needed, combine gauge checks with calibrated measuring tools or coordinate measuring machines to document dimensional data.

Key features to look for when selecting ring and plug gauges

  • Material and Hardness: Durable construction to resist wear and maintain calibration over time.
  • Tolerances and Standards Compliance: Norm-compliant manufacturing to ensure interchangeability and reliable acceptance criteria.
  • Surface Finish and Fit Class: Appropriate finish and fit for the mating parts and application environment.
  • Calibration and Traceability: Availability of calibration certificates and the ability to recheck and recalibrate as required.
  • Application-Specific Design: Options such as thread gauges, stepped plugs or split rings for specialized requirements.
